What happened

SecurityWeek RSS feed covering coordinated intrusions against internet-exposed water-sector PLCs, corporate cybersecurity acquisitions and funding, risks from abandoned DNS records, and a disclosed data breach at Analog Devices. The primary threat report highlights CISA guidance for utilities to secure operational technology following attacks affecting dozens of Minnesota systems.
